Fall 2024 Web Grading Now Open (Targeted Message) /registrar/2024/12/10/fall-grading-now-open Fall 2024 Web Grading Now Open (Targeted Message) Anonymous (not verified) Tue, 12/10/2024 - 00:00 Tags: Faculty & Staff Announcements Fall 2023 Grading Targeted (Fac/Staff) Office of the Registrar Who Received This Email?

We sent this email on Tuesday, Dec. 10, 2024, to instructors with post access who had unapproved grades in one or more Fall 2024 classes (law, specialized program, thesis and dissertation classes excluded).

Dear [instructor],

Web grading is now open. Please submit your grades in for the following class(es):

Class InfoClass #Class Description# Enrolled
    

To support student success, be sure to enter, approve and post each class's grades by the deadline below:

Final Exam DateWeb Grading Deadline
Saturday, Dec. 14Wednesday, Dec. 18, 11:59 p.m.
Sunday, Dec. 15Thursday, Dec. 19, 11:59 p.m.
Monday, Dec. 16Friday, Dec. 20, 11:59 p.m.
Tuesday, Dec. 17Saturday, Dec. 21, 11:59 p.m.
Wednesday, Dec. 18Sunday, Dec. 22, 11:59 p.m.

All grades must be posted by the final grading deadline, Sunday, Dec. 23, 2024, to avoid causing serious negative consequences for your students, which may include academic standing, financial aid and graduation eligibility.

Special session class's grades must be entered, approved and posted within four days after the last day of class. See Fall 2024 Special Session Grade Processing Calendars.

If you're in need of first-time training or a thorough refresher,  this Friday, Dec. 13, from 11 a.m. to noon.

All instructors must indicate the level of course participation and last date of participation (if applicable) for all assigned incomplete and failing grades. Instructions are provided at the top of each grade roster.
